CHRISTIAN SCIENCE.
ITS FOUNDER CHANGES HER PLACE OF RESIDENCE. By Teltfirtah.— Prwts Association.— rowrichi. (Received February 6, 8.52 a.m.) NEW YORK, sth February. Mrs. Eddy has left Concord and resides in ft splendid mansion in Boston. Mary Baker Glover Eddy, "discoverer and founder of Christian Science," has been reported to bfi in bad health, but recent litigation went to prove that she still retains possession of her faculties, and is capable of carrying on the business part of her religion.
